Analysis of Bagpipes



Haunting sound of bagpipes played across the dial
I glanced across the pastures
green across the isle.

Elsewhere ‘cross the stony walls sheep in woolen coat
were grazing ‘cross the pastures
I smiled.

One day I’d wrote
about these very pastures, these fields, these rocky shores,
where little towns remained the same.

I told you years before
I’d make this trip some summer day, wind rose at my back.
I’d grasp a piece of luggage last week,

and as I packed
I thought I heard the crashing waves, thought I saw the spray
of ocean rising o’er the rock

while bagpipes fade away.
